Lizzy Hawker is a British long-distance runner who has become one of the most successful endurance athletes in the world. She started her career as a schoolgirl running the streets of London and went on to become the 100km Womens World Champion, win the Ultra Trail du Mont Blanc an unprecedented five times, hold the world record for 24 hours road running, and become the first woman to stand on the overall winners podium at Spartathlon. Her remarkable spirit was recognised in 2013 when she was a National Geographic Adventurer of the Year.

Lizzy Hawker's journey from a schoolgirl running the streets of London to a world-record-breaking athlete racing on mountains is an incredible tale of determination and resilience. Scared witless and surrounded by a sea of people, Lizzy stood in the church square at the center of Chamonix on a late August evening, waiting for the start of the Ultra Trail du Mont Blanc. The mountains towering over the pack of runners promised a grueling 8,600 meters of ascent and descent over 158 kilometers of challenging terrain that would test the feet, legs, heart, and mind. These nervous moments before the race signaled not just the beginning of nearly twenty-seven hours of effort that saw Lizzy finish as the first woman, but the start of the career of one of Britain's most successful endurance athletes.

Lizzy went on to achieve remarkable feats, including becoming the 100km Women's World Champion, winning the Ultra Trail du Mont Blanc an unprecedented five times, holding the world record for 24 hours road running, and becoming the first woman to stand on the overall winners podium at Spartathlon. An innate endurance and natural affinity with the mountains have led Lizzy to push herself to the absolute limits, including a staggering 320-kilometer run through the Himalayas, from Everest Base Camp to Kathmandu in Nepal.

Lizzy's remarkable spirit was recognized in 2013 when she was named a National Geographic Adventurer of the Year. These ultimate challenges ask not just what the feet and legs can do but question the inner thoughts and contemplations of a runner.

Lizzy's astonishing story uncovers the physical, mental, and emotional challenges that runners go through at the edge of human endurance, inspiring us to get out of the chair and go running in the mountains.
